Alaska Lake Kayaking

Looking for a quiet way to explore the Alaskan wilderness? Lake kayaking in Alaska offers calm water, incredible views, and a chance to see wildlife up close. Paddle across pristine lakes like Eklutna, Kenai, or Byers Lake, surrounded by mountains, forests, and even glaciers.

It’s perfect for beginners and families, with kayak rentals and guided tours available in many locations. Whether you’re in Southcentral, Interior, or the Kenai Peninsula, lake kayaking in Alaska is a must-do summer adventure.

Grab a pad­dle and set off in a kayak across the glac­i­er-fed turquoise waters of Eklut­na Lake with expe­ri­enced tour com­pa­ny Life­time Adven­tures. You’ll have the option of rent­ing a kayak or enjoy­ing a guid­ed tour around the lake in a sin­gle or dou­ble kayak — no expe­ri­ence nec­es­sary! Com­bi­na­tion tours that include bik­ing or hik­ing are also available.

Based in Haines, SEAK Expe­di­tions offers immer­sive, small-group day tours by kayak, bike, and pack­raft, all led by pas­sion­ate locals. Tours include the Chilkoot Lake Kayak, Bike & Kayak Tour, Day on the Fjord sea kayak­ing, and Kle­hi­ni Riv­er Pack­raft­ing. Small groups allow lead­ers to cus­tomize tours to trav­el­ers’ inter­ests, whether that’s geol­o­gy, his­to­ry, pho­tog­ra­phy, or wildlife.

Seward Adven­ture Park is an all-in-one out­door activ­i­ty cen­ter sur­round­ed by the moun­tains of Res­ur­rec­tion Bay. Try the aer­i­al ropes course up to 45 feet high, bike grav­el trails through alder forests, kayak on Preacher’s Pond, or try zorb­ing across the water. You can also enjoy axe throw­ing and archery tag. Book a sin­gle activ­i­ty or opt for a half- or full-day pass to try everything.
